4
   AROMA 9/10   APPEARANCE 4/5   TASTE 7/10   PALATE 5/5   OVERALL 15/20
fiulijn (12179) - Malmö, DENMARK - SEP 9, 2011
Draught at Mikkeller Bar, Copenhagen
Cloudy dark amber color; small head. The aroma is an explosion of fruits (apricots, mango, tangerine, plums and more), with a cheesy component (mind: cheese rind, mold, cheese cellar). The body is well constructed and round; there is a strong flavor of toffee, enough residual sweetness, hop fruitiness, but also some cheese that here is less desirable (melted cheese); expected hop resins, and bitter oranges. In the final also the alcohol is perceived, but just as mouth warmer. So in the end it’s quite chaotic, but still a powerful brew, and a good one.
